Sometimes the hardest voice to find is your own - but it can change everything once you do. 

 

Billy Plimpton has one big dream: to be a stand-up comedian. He’s got the jokes, the timing, and the imagination, but there’s one problem. Billy has a stammer, and that makes saying even a few words feel like climbing a mountain. How can he make people laugh when getting the words out feels impossible?

Inspired by her own son’s experience, Helen Rutter crafts a funny, moving, and empowering story about courage, resilience, and the power of embracing what makes you different. As Billy learns to face his fears, he discovers that being a comedian isn’t about having a perfect voice - it’s about having something worth saying.

With warmth and honesty, THE BOY WHO MADE EVERYONE LAUGH shines a light on the strength that comes from vulnerability and the bravery it takes to stand tall - on stage and in life. Perfect for readers aged 9–13, classrooms, and anyone who’s ever doubted themselves but dreamed big anyway.
